Output e29faf156a398614e405de401f3aef400dbe4c4869a63141693e53fb160547d6:60

value
841761
script pubkey
OP_HASH160 OP_PUSHBYTES_20 0a57bd6d539616fe43ce48d8256fcdd91cbc4960 OP_EQUAL
address
32dhnjuhWv4u4xc27RMhy2CWg6hzrKbW8a
transaction
e29faf156a398614e405de401f3aef400dbe4c4869a63141693e53fb160547d6
spent
true